
The Work Life Balance at Twitter is rated a B by 187 employees putting it in the Top 35% of similar size companies on Comparably. 82% of Twitter employees are satisfied with their work life balance while 37% feel they are burnt out. A well proportioned work life balance is necessary to keep employees happy and productive.
About 59% of the employees at Twitter work eight hours or less, while 14% of them have a very long day - longer than twelve hours. The Majority of Twitter employees are satisfied with their work life balance and do not feel burnt out.
In general, employees with Entry Level experience and employees in the Product department believe they have good work life balance while employees in the Finance department and Non-Binary employees think there is room for improvement.
